1. A machine having at least one motor operable to propel the machine and to at least one implement actuator, the machine having an engine operative at a speed controlled by an underspeed setting, the machine comprising:

  • at least one transmission connected to the at least one motor operating to propel the machine;

    an electronic controller associated with the machine, the electronic controller disposed to receive data corresponding to at least one machine operating parameter relative to the at least one transmission, wherein the at least one machine operating parameter includes;

    a first parameter, which is indicative of a pressure of fluid at the at least one motor; and

    a second parameter, which is indicative of a pressure of fluid at the at least one implement actuator;

    the electronic controller being further disposed to process the data corresponding to the at least one machine operating parameter to determine an operating mode of the machine and to adapt the underspeed setting for the engine based on the operating mode.
